Web6 apr. 2024 · Access the Settings app and tap on the WiFi option. Locate the WiFi connection you wish to erase and press the “i” button next to it. Hit the Forget this Network button to erase the network. From the WiFi menu, press the connection again, and enter the correct password to complete this method.
